Point System

The Point System is an important tool that assists the New York State Department of Motor Vehicles determine high risk drivers and take action accordingly. By appointing point worths to particular traffic offenses, the system flags these offenses immediately so that the DMV can investigate and possibly set into motion administrative fines, suspensions and more. Yonkers and White Plains traffic ticket legal representative Elisa Claro has counseled many motorists regarding the state's complex Point System and its consequences.

As a basic rule, any traffic offense that is categorized as moving infraction will have points evaluated on one's driving record. Non-moving offenses, such as parking tickets, do not usually have actually any points associated with them. A driver will have their license suspended if they get 12 or more points within 18 months.

A driver's insurance rates might likewise increase if they receive too lots of points. This is because insurance provider see drivers with extreme points on their records as being greater threat, which causes them charging greater premiums for coverage.

Depending on the state, some systems may permit a driver to have their points expunged after a certain amount of time. Others, nevertheless, will continue to have them on a person's record for longer.

Those who are dealing with a possible license suspension due to excessive points ought to understand the Driver Licensing Compact (DLC) contract between states. Under this arrangement, any DLC member state that convicts a driver of breaching its traffic laws will interact details of the conviction to the person's licensing state, which may then do something about it as it would have done had actually the person been convicted because jurisdiction. This could consist of having the individual's license suspended until they pay a fine, or in many cases, even completely. Administrative Action

An individual can lose their license for numerous factors. In some cases, the suspension is the outcome of a court conviction, however there are likewise cases where the driver is apprehended for a traffic offense such as driving under the influence (DUI), and an administrative license suspension is ordered. These suspensions aren't the same as a criminal conviction, because an individual still has the right to challenge the decision.

Lots of people do not understand that if they get a ticket in one state, it can affect their home state's license too. This is since a lot of states participate in the Driver's License Compact, which implies that they share info about drivers with each other. This includes the details of any traffic ticket convictions and any administrative action that was taken versus the driver.

The majority of these types of administrative suspensions don't require a conviction in court, and they are frequently based upon an arrest instead of a charge or proof. For instance, a DUI arrest can activate an automatic suspension, if the driver is discovered to have a blood alcohol content above a particular level or declines to take a breath test. These types of administrative suspensions might only last a short quantity of time, nevertheless, and there's usually a method to contest the choice.

The driver needs to generally request a hearing before the DMV to object to a suspension. Throughout this hearing, the commissioner or other person who chooses the case will examine the truths and evidence. They will then decide whether the driver's advantages ought to be suspended, and if so, the length of the suspension. The driver has a restricted amount of time to ask for the hearing, and if they don't do so in a timely manner, the suspension will immediately enter into impact.

If the suspension is too long, a driver can send an attract the DMV's Appeals Board. This appeal should be submitted within 60 days of the denial letter. If the driver is able to show that the DMV has actually acted arbitrarily and capriciously, it will reassess the case. If the appeal is not successful, the driver can ask a federal court to review it.
